Why High-Pressure Plumbing Repair Happens in Freeland
Local conditions in Freeland, WA make these causes common for High-Pressure Plumbing Repair requests.
- Municipal supply pressure spikes
- Failed or missing pressure reducing valve
- Thermal expansion without expansion tank
